Review of

Heathlands House

from J P (Husband of Resident) published on 13 January 2025
Overall Experience  Overall Experience 3.0 out of 5

My wife was given excellent care by a dedicated and friendly team of multinational carers. However, my request to have a bed with bedrails was initially ignored, as the assessor said there was a danger of her climbing over the rails. She has never done this in 5 years of short stays in care homes and
the first night she fell out of the bed and had to move rooms to where a railed bed was available. She also received little exercise on the first floor (I heard ground floor residents invited to take part in sessions) but respect she was on the dementia floor, where there was also no chance of a lucid conversation at meal times. My wife is only suffering from memory loss and is quite compos mentis. Finally, I passed on requests for a chiropody visit but this did not happen. So, overall, the standard of care was fine at base level but the extras we might expect for £3920 were missing. We were even asked to provide incontinence pads and medication (which I supplied in full) tendered without explanation or consultation.

Review of

Heathlands House

from E M (Relative of Resident) published on 15 November 2024
Overall Experience  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5

My aunt arrived at the home having fractured her hip. She was unable to walk and was quite confused by the fall, the surgery, the anaesthetic and the move from her home to the hospital to care home. By the end of her 3-month stay, she was back to her normal self, or even better than she was at her own
home just before the fall. She was able to walk, thanks to the excellent physiotherapy, she was socialising around the lunch and supper table, she was whizzing around in the wheelchair, and even had a much-needed haircut. She really enjoyed the lovely garden, sitting out in the sun over the summer with a cup of tea and a piece of cake. She thoroughly enjoyed the food - home-cooked and ample in portions. The room was a lovely large size with good en suite facilities. Visiting was at any time. She only left to go and live with a relative.
